Job Description
Experienced Welder/Fabricator, Welder A (2nd Shift, Full-Time) $24.00
- 28.
Shift Premium Schedule:
Monday-Thursday, 2:00pm-12:00amPOSITION SUMMARY
Under the direction of the Team Lead or Plant Management Team, the Experienced Welder/Fabricator will set up and tack weld a wide range of similar and dissimilar metals to make sub-assemblies for cylinders and swivels and set up sub arc and weld per Weld Procedure Specifications (WPS).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Repair of weld flaws/leakers from assembly. 2. Tack and weld parts per the appropriate weld procedure. 3. Clean and inspect all finished sub-assemblies as trained. 4. Store finished sub-assemblies and un-used parts per proper procedures. 5. Read and interpret shop routings and prints. 6. Set-up the job per the appropriate weld procedures and work instruction using fixtures and jigs where applicable. 7. Perform and obtain the first part piece inspection. 8. General maintenance- changing tips, liners, wire, gas, etc.
E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E
1. High school diploma or equivalent. 2. (2) Two years associate degree in Welding with one or more years in a variety of welding techniques.LICENSES AND CERTIFICATIONS
1. Must be able to pass the JARP Industries weld certification test. 2. Required to pass all weld certification tests within 2 years of hire. Each weld process is re-certified at 3-year intervals. 3. May be directed to perform other tasks due to a decrease in the workload, machine is down for maintenance or a critical need exists in another area.QUALIFICATIONS AND SKILLS
1. Welding experience is a must in flux core, sub-arc and MIG. 2. Must be able to read blueprint. 3. Manufacturing experience.
